Research Areas of Focus
Researchers are actively investigating the synergistic properties of the BPC-157 and TB-500 (Wolverine) blend across several key biological domains, including:
-
Accelerated Musculoskeletal Tissue Repair: Evaluating how the combination speeds healing in model organisms with torn ligaments, tendonitis (such as Achilles injuries), and acute skeletal muscle tears.
-
Synergistic Angiogenesis and Microvascularization: Investigating how BPC-157’s nitric oxide pathways pair with TB-500’s endothelial cell migration to promote rapid blood vessel growth to poorly vascularized tissues.
-
Actin Regulation and Cellular Migration: Studying the mechanism by which TB-500 upregulates actin dynamics to direct repair-promoting cells to injured target locations.
-
Extracellular Matrix and Collagen Deposition: Exploring how the co-administration enhances the synthesis of Type I and Type III collagen, reinforcing tendon-to-bone structural strength.
-
Systemic Inflammatory Modulation: Assessing the blend’s capability to downregulate pro-inflammatory cytokines, reducing localized pain, joint swelling, and tissue fibrosis.
